Position: Freedom Boat Club - Boating Instructor in Tampa, FL (Bilingual)

Position Overview

As part of the talented Freedom Boat Club training team, the Instructor trains and onboards our club members through virtual classroom and on‑the‑water training. The role is part‑time with flexible hours and requires availability on weekdays and weekends as needed.

Essential Functions
  • Greet and welcome new members
  • Organize and conduct member classroom and on‑the‑water training on skill, policy, and compliance areas
  • Identify needed or beneficial additional training
  • Record training certifications in the Reservation system
  • Maintain professional appearance and uniform
  • Handle minor member mishaps or incidents while maintaining a friendly disposition
  • Provide red‑carpet level of treatment to members and guests
  • Speak with potential members about the Club
  • Perform additional duties as assigned
Required Qualifications
  • US Coast Guard Captains license
  • Pass a background check and drug screen
  • Valid driver's license and good driving record
  • Boating experience in or around boats
  • Vision adequate to read / manipulate handheld computer tablets
  • Electronics knowledge & utilization (smartphone/tablet)
  • Ability to maintain a calm, positive attitude during periods of high activity
  • Cooperative, team attitude when working with supervisors and fellow employees
  • Highly effective communication skills and friendly customer service
  • Professional communication skills with co‑workers, corporate, and members
  • Self‑starter, capable of working unsupervised
  • High attention to detail
  • Adhere to all safety policies
Preferred Qualifications
  • Bilingual (English and Spanish)
  • Previous instructor experience is highly desirable
Working Conditions
  • Moving from docks to boats and vice versa, unstable & wet surfaces
  • Large drops (~4ft) down to vessels & back up to dock
  • Stand for long periods of time
  • Outside elements (heat, rain, cold, general extreme weather)
  • Work in a marina setting on docks that may be fixed or floating
  • Work near and on the water
  • Safely move on, off and in vessels during various tide and weather conditions
Compensation & Benefits

Pay rate: $20/hr eligible to participate in Brunswick benefit offerings including 401(k) (up to 4% match), wellbeing program, and product purchase discounts.
